excel怎么把数字自动成顺序

excel怎么把数字自动成顺序

Excel实现数字自动排序的方法主要包括:使用填充柄、序列生成、公式计算、VBA宏代码。在这四个方法中,使用填充柄和序列生成是最常见且最简单的方法。下面将详细介绍如何使用这些方法来实现Excel中数字的自动排序。

一、使用填充柄

使用填充柄是Excel中最常见的方法之一,它可以轻松地将一系列数字按顺序填充到指定的单元格中。

1. 基本操作

首先,在Excel中选择一个单元格并输入起始数字。例如,输入“1”到A1单元格中。然后,将鼠标移动到该单元格右下角的小方块(填充柄)上,当鼠标指针变成一个小十字时,按住鼠标左键并向下拖动,直到你希望填充的范围。释放鼠标左键后,你会发现所有选中的单元格都已按顺序填充了数字。

2. 更复杂的序列

如果你希望填充一个更复杂的序列,例如每隔一个数字递增,可以输入两个数字来指定增长模式。例如,输入“1”到A1,输入“3”到A2,然后选择这两个单元格并使用填充柄向下拖动。Excel会自动识别并按相同的间隔填充序列。

二、使用序列生成

Excel的“填充”功能还可以通过序列生成选项来实现更复杂的自动排序。

1. 基本操作

在Excel中选择一个起始单元格并输入起始数字。例如,在A1单元格中输入“1”。然后,选择“开始”选项卡,找到“填充”按钮,点击它并选择“序列”。在弹出的对话框中,可以设置序列的类型(行或列)、步长值(每次增加的数值)和终止值(序列的结束数字)。设置完成后,点击“确定”,Excel会自动生成符合要求的数字序列。

2. 自定义序列

如果你需要生成一个特定的自定义序列,例如每次增加5,可以在“序列”对话框中设置步长值为“5”,并设置终止值为你希望的最大数字。这样,Excel会自动生成一个以5为间隔的数字序列。

三、使用公式计算

除了使用填充柄和序列生成,Excel还可以通过公式计算来实现数字的自动排序。

1. 基本公式

在Excel中输入公式可以自动生成数字序列。例如,在A1单元格中输入“1”,然后在A2单元格中输入公式“=A1+1”,按下回车键。选择A2单元格并使用填充柄向下拖动,Excel会自动按序填充数字。

2. 更复杂的公式

如果你需要生成一个更复杂的数字序列,例如每次增加2,可以在A2单元格中输入公式“=A1+2”。按下回车键后,选择A2单元格并使用填充柄向下拖动,Excel会自动按序填充符合要求的数字。

四、使用VBA宏代码

对于需要处理大量数据或进行复杂操作的用户,使用VBA宏代码可以实现更灵活和自动化的数字排序。

1. 基本操作

首先,打开Excel并按下“Alt + F11”进入VBA编辑器。选择“插入”并点击“模块”来创建一个新的模块。在模块中输入以下代码:

Sub GenerateSequence()

Dim i As Integer

For i = 1 To 100 ' 这里的100可以替换为你需要的终止值

Cells(i, 1).Value = i

Next i

End Sub

然后关闭VBA编辑器,回到Excel中,按下“Alt + F8”打开宏对话框,选择刚才创建的“GenerateSequence”宏并点击“运行”。你会看到A列从A1到A100单元格被按顺序填充了数字。

2. 自定义宏

如果你需要生成一个更复杂的数字序列,可以修改VBA代码。例如,每次增加5:

Sub GenerateCustomSequence()

Dim i As Integer

For i = 1 To 20 ' 这里的20可以替换为你需要的终止值

Cells(i, 1).Value = i * 5

Next i

End Sub

运行这个宏后,A列将按5的间隔填充数字。

通过以上四种方法,你可以在Excel中轻松实现数字的自动排序,无论是简单的顺序递增还是复杂的自定义序列。选择最适合你的方法,可以大大提高你的工作效率。

相关问答FAQs:

1. 问题: 我在Excel中如何将数字自动排序?
回答: 在Excel中,你可以使用排序功能轻松地将数字自动排序。以下是具体步骤:

  1. 选中你想要排序的数字所在的列或行。
  2. 在Excel的菜单栏中选择“数据”选项卡。
  3. 点击“排序”按钮,弹出排序对话框。
  4. 在排序对话框中,选择要排序的列或行,然后选择排序顺序(升序或降序)。
  5. 点击“确定”按钮,Excel将自动按照你选择的顺序对数字进行排序。

2. 问题: 如何在Excel中按照多个条件自动排序数字?
回答: 如果你希望按照多个条件对数字进行排序,Excel提供了强大的排序功能。以下是具体步骤:

  1. 选中你想要排序的数字所在的列或行。
  2. 在Excel的菜单栏中选择“数据”选项卡。
  3. 点击“排序”按钮,弹出排序对话框。
  4. 在排序对话框中,选择要排序的第一个条件的列或行,并选择排序顺序。
  5. 点击“添加级别”按钮,添加更多的排序条件。
  6. 按照相同的步骤选择其他排序条件和排序顺序。
  7. 点击“确定”按钮,Excel将根据你选择的多个条件自动排序数字。

3. 问题: 如何在Excel中对含有空格的数字进行自动排序?
回答: 如果你的数字中含有空格,你仍然可以在Excel中进行自动排序。以下是具体步骤:

  1. 选中你想要排序的数字所在的列或行。
  2. 在Excel的菜单栏中选择“数据”选项卡。
  3. 点击“排序”按钮,弹出排序对话框。
  4. 在排序对话框中,选择要排序的列或行,并选择排序顺序。
  5. 在排序对话框的右下角,点击“选项”按钮。
  6. 在“选项”对话框中,勾选“忽略空格”选项。
  7. 点击“确定”按钮,Excel将自动按照你选择的顺序对数字进行排序,忽略空格。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4469648

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部